** The home solar market in Sand Point, Alaska, is characterized by its niche, high-specialization nature. Due to the remote location, harsh coastal environment (high winds, salt air, heavy snow), and the community's reliance on a local diesel-powered grid, solar installations are complex and require significant expertise. There is no local competition within the city; homeowners must contract with established statewide firms based primarily in Anchorage or the Mat-Su Valley. These providers are highly experienced but their services come at a premium due to high logistics and mobilization costs. Typical pricing for a full off-grid or battery-backed system is significantly higher than the national average, often ranging from $40,000 to $80,000 or more, depending on energy needs and the level of battery storage required. However, the high cost of diesel generation makes solar a financially viable long-term investment, and providers are well-versed in navigating state-specific incentives and federal programs like the USDA's Rural Energy for America Program (REAP) to help offset costs.
